写点什么

YashanDB 的可扩展性对业务增长有何支持?

作者:数据库砖家
  • 2025-06-26
    广东
  • 本文字数:1406 字

    阅读完需:约 5 分钟

在当今数据驱动的市场环境下,企业面临着快速增长和不断变化的需求。如何有效处理和存储海量数据,确保高可用性和可扩展性,成为了摆在企业面前的一大挑战。特别是在数据库技术层面,迅速而高效的扩展能力直接影响着企业的业务增长。YashanDB 作为一款高性能、高可用的数据库,其可扩展性将为企业提供强有力的支持。本文将深入分析 YashanDB 的可扩展性及其对业务增长的支持作用。

YashanDB 的体系结构与可扩展性

YashanDB 采用了多层架构设计,支持单机、分布式集群和共享集群三种部署模式,旨在解决不同场景下的扩展需求。无论是小型企业还是大型企业,YashanDB 皆能提供高效的解决方案,结合其灵活的存储引擎和强大的事务管理能力,确保在负载增加的情况下,仍然能够高效运行。

1. 部署架构的灵活性

在 YashanDB 中,用户可以根据需求选择合适的部署方式:

 

单机部署:适用于小型应用,允许快速部署与便捷的操作,便于进行初步的数据存储和处理。

分布式集群部署:通过各数据节点之间的负载均衡,能够显著提高数据库的处理能力与性能,适用于对数据处理能力有较高要求的业务。

共享集群部署:允许多个实例并行读写数据,实现更高的可用性和扩展性,适合对性能和高可用性有迫切需求的核心交易场景。

 

2. 数据存储与管理的高效性

YashanDB 的存储引擎采用了段、页、块三级结构,极大地提高了数据访问速度与存储效率。通过灵活的表空间管理,企业能够根据业务需求动态调整存储空间,确保系统的运行效率与性能。在大数据量情况下,YashanDB 能够通过自动扩展数据文件和分区,快速适应业务的增长。

YashanDB 的可扩展性带来的业务增长支持

1. 高可用性与业务连续性

YashanDB 提供的主备复制机制确保了数据的及时备份与高可用性,有效减少因故障带来的业务中断风险。YashanDB 的在线故障自动切换能力,可以在主实例出现问题时,无需人工干预地转移业务至备实例,确保业务持续运行.

2. 性能优化与可靠性

在高并发请求的场景下,YashanDB 能够通过其分布式架构与负载均衡能力,优化数据库性能。通过横向扩展,通过增加新节点的方式,YashanDB 可以承载更大规模的数据,同时保持良好的访问性能,帮助企业在用户增长时快速响应需求变化.

3. 动态数据处理能力

YashanDB 支持多种数据处理能力,包括行存、列存表的灵活选择以及高效的存储引擎设计。在数据分析、报表生成等场景中,YashanDB 能够根据所需场景快速调整存储结构和查询方式,从而减少数据处理时间,有效支持大规模数据分析。

4. 管理的便捷性与高效性

通过 YashanDB 的管理工具,运维人员能够轻松监控数据库性能、调整配置,及时响应突发事件。这种便捷性为企业提供了一个高效的管理平台,使能够将更多精力集中在业务开发与创新上,而非繁琐的运维操作.

总结与建议

 

根据企业的实际需求,合理选择 YashanDB 的部署方式,以最大化数据处理能力和资源利用效率。

定期评估和调整数据存储架构和索引策略,确保系统能随时应对业务增长带来的压力。

充分利用 YashanDB 的高可用性特性,保障业务在数据故障时的连续性。

持续关注 YashanDB 的版本更新与新特性,积极引入最新的技术与工具,提高数据库运维效率。

 

结论

随着数据规模的不断增长,企业对数据库技术提出了更高的要求,YashanDB 的可扩展性正是应对这一挑战的有效工具。其灵活的体系架构、高效的存储管理与强大的事务管理能力,让企业在快速发展中保持数据的安全性和一致性。随着技术的不断进步,企业亦需不断学习与适应,确保能在日益激烈的市场竞争中保持领先地位。

用户头像

还未添加个人签名 2025-04-09 加入

还未添加个人简介

评论

发布
暂无评论
YashanDB的可扩展性对业务增长有何支持?_数据库砖家_InfoQ写作社区